What to Eat

Ocampo is known for its traditional Mexican cuisine. Some of the most popular dishes include:

  • Pozole: A traditional Mexican soup made with hominy, pork, and vegetables.
  • Tostadas: A crispy corn tortilla topped with various ingredients, such as seafood, meat, or vegetables.
  • Tamales: A cornmeal dough steamed in a corn husk, filled with various ingredients, such as meat, cheese, or vegetables.
